Troy Township is a township in Clarke County, Iowa, USA. As of the 2000 census, its population was 1,021.

Geography

Troy Township covers an area of 36.1 square miles (93 km2) and contains one incorporated settlement, Murray. According to the USGS, it contains two cemeteries: Murray and Troy.

The stream of West Long Creek runs through this township.
